South Florida High Schools In State Semifinals

     There were eight South Florida high schools from the tri-county area that moved on to the FHSAA football state semifinals. 17 high schools from the local region were involved in the regional finals. 
     Palm Beach Central was the only Palm Beach County high school that went to the next round. Palm Beach Gardens, Cardinal Newman and Pahokee were all eliminated from the postseason. 
     Broward County fell from six high schools to three. St. Thomas Aquinas, American Heritage and Chaminade-Madonna were victorious while Cardinal Gibbons, Blanche Ely and Miramar lost. 
     Dade County dropped from seven to four high schools. Miami Central, Columbus, Homestead and True North Academy advanced. Miami Norland, Doral Academy and Palmer Trinity were defeated.
